Periklis Vyzantios captured this image, titled "Figures", using oil paint on canvas. Here we see symbols of status and formality—the top hats and dark coats hark back to earlier eras of bourgeois society. The attire suggests a world of social rituals, of class distinctions and hierarchies, a world obsessed with the theater. The formal attire, with its roots in traditions, also mirrors the attire found in religious ceremonies. It is like a secular echo of garments worn by priests and dignitaries. The attire points to the human need to create systems of power, whether in the church or the theater. It speaks to our collective subconscious need for order. These symbols, though adapted and secularized, still retain an emotional weight, a somberness that echoes the gravity of earlier, sacred forms. The human need for ritual and performance evolves, yet always remains.
